码迷,mamicode.com
首页 > 其他好文 > 详细

PSoC3开发板,无需昂贵的MiniProg3,CY8C3866AXI-040,内置USB BootLoader

时间:2015-01-27 13:12:41      阅读:1107      评论:0      收藏:0      [点我收藏+]

标签:

学习PSoC3一定需要使用Miniprog3编程器吗?为大家分享一个IFLabs性价比很高的PSoC3开发板。

无需昂贵的Miniprog3编程器也可以轻松开发和学习PSoC3,基于功能强大的CY8C3866AXI-040芯片,开发板上内置USB BootLoader。

开发板详情:http://item.taobao.com/item.htm?id=43495032490
了解IFLabs淘宝店铺:IdeaFutureLab

1.1 基本功能概述

开发板主要用于Cypress PSoC3系列芯片的学习和开发,以CY8C3866AXI-040芯片为核心,提供供电接口,并将所有用户可以使用的IO引脚引出,方便用户的学习和开发。同时,为了便于用户学习,开发板内置了USB BootLoader程序,用户无需购买昂贵的Cypress MiniProg3编程器,仅需安装PSoC Creator开发环境便可以完成程序的开发和下载调试。

本开发板的基本功能如下:

  • 基于功能最全、性能最强的Cypress PSoC3系列CY8C3866AXI-040芯片,便于用户学习和开发PSoC3系列微处理器的全部组件功能。
  • 提供多项供电接口选择,可以使用USB接口供电、外接5V直流电源供电以及外部电池供电,便于用户适应各种学习和开发环境。
  • 将全部的可用IO引脚引出,每一组IO引脚均可以灵活选择3.3V5VVBoost等端口电压。
  • 开发板内建一个21×24焊盘阵列,便于用户进行接线、扩展外围器件等各项测试。
  • 开发板上所有焊盘阵列以及IO引脚引出接口之间均采用2.54mm标准间距,可以将开发板作为核心板使用。
  • 内置USB BootLoader程序,用户无需购买昂贵的Cypress MiniProg3编程器,在PSoC Creator开发环境下便可以直接对PSoC3芯片进行程序开发、固件下载等开发调试工作,降低学习成本和难度。
  • 开发板提供了5×2的编程接口,适配Cypress MiniProg3编程器,便于用户使用MiniProg3编程器进行开发。
  • 提供开发板电路原理图及手把手开发范例,用户可以实现快速入门开发。

 

 

1.2 开发板结构PSoC3 DevKit V1.0开发套件包括开发板*1,USB线*1,光盘*1,跳线*2,如图1.1所示。技术分享

整个开发板大小为130mm*105mm,其结构如图1.2所示。各个组成部分介绍如下:

技术分享

 

  • PSoC3 CY8C3866AXI-040:开发板核心器件,CY8C3866AXI-040最小系统电路。
  • USB接口:负责USB供电、USB数据传输以及USB BootLoader更新固件程序。
  • 供电选择:用于选择USB供电或者外部5V供电,以及VddaVddd的电压选择。
  • 外部5V供电接口:在使用外部5V供电时,+5V直流电源通过这里输入开发板。
  • Vboost选择:用于在使用片上升压转换器的情况下进行选择。
  • 外部电池供电接口:在使用片上升压转换器的情况下,外部电池类低电压通过这里输入开发板。
  • Vddio0引脚区:由Vddio0控制的IO引脚区,每一个IO引脚均引出4个焊盘,其中一个为插针、一个为插孔,其余两个空余由用户根据需要来焊接使用。
  • Vddio0电压选择:用于选择Vddio0引脚区所有IO的工作电压,可以选择GND+5VD+3.3VD或者Vboost
  • Vddio1引脚区:由Vddio1控制的IO引脚区,每一个IO引脚均引出4个焊盘,其中一个为插针、一个为插孔,其余两个空余由用户根据需要来焊接使用。
  • Vddio1电压选择:用于选择Vddio1引脚区所有IO的工作电压,可以选择GND+5VD+3.3VD或者Vboost
  • Vddio2引脚区:由Vddio2控制的IO引脚区,每一个IO引脚均引出4个焊盘,其中一个为插针、一个为插孔,其余两个空余由用户根据需要来焊接使用。
  • Vddio2电压选择:用于选择Vddio2引脚区所有IO的工作电压,可以选择GND+5VD+3.3VD或者Vboost
  • Vddio3引脚区:由Vddio3控制的IO引脚区,每一个IO引脚均引出4个焊盘,其中一个为插针、一个为插孔,其余两个空余由用户根据需要来焊接使用。
  • Vddio3电压选择:用于选择Vddio3引脚区所有IO的工作电压,可以选择GND+5VD+3.3VD或者Vboost
  • 复位开关:用于对板上PSoC3芯片执行复位操作。
  • MiniProg3编程接口:用于通过MiniProg3编程器来对板上PSoC3芯片执行编程下载操作。
  • GND测试点*4:有4个测试点,连接电路板的GND,方便使用鳄鱼夹、示波器探头等夹持来进行测试操作。
  • 常用电压:将GND+3.3V+5V等常用电压引出,方便功能测试时使用。
  • 2.54mm焊盘阵列:开发板内建一个21×24焊盘阵列,采用2.54mm100mil)标准间距,便于用户进行接线、扩展外围器件等各项测试。

 

1.3光盘文件说明

 

本开发套件光盘中提供了如下一些资源:

  • USB BootLoader目标文件:提供本开发板使用USB BootLoader功能开发所必须的支持文件。
  • DATest:第4章开发实例源代码。
  • PSoC USB Example:第5章开发实例源代码,包括Normal固件程序、Bootloadable固件程序、驱动程序、上位机程序。
  • VBoostTest:第6章开发实例源代码。
  • PSoC3 DevKit V1.0 电路原理图.pdf:本开发板电路原理图。
  • PSoC3DevKit.pdf:本开发板开发手册。
  • PSoC3 CY8C38系列数据手册(中文).pdf:中文版元器件数据手册。
  • PSoC3 CY8C38系列数据手册(英文).pdf:英文版元器件数据手册。
  • PSoC3 Architecture TRM.pdfPSoC3系列构架说明。
  • PSoC3 Registers TRM.pdfPSoC3系列寄存器说明。

PSoC3DevKit开发手册目录:

技术分享

技术分享

本开发板默认顺丰包邮,为您提供最快最优质的快递服务。对于开发板使用过程中的任何疑问,均提供全程技术支持。

IFLabs致力于最优质服务,高性价比,选用优质快递,努力让每一个开发者满意。

开发板详情:http://item.taobao.com/item.htm?id=43495032490
关注IFLabs淘宝店铺:IdeaFutureLab

PSoC3开发板,无需昂贵的MiniProg3,CY8C3866AXI-040,内置USB BootLoader

标签:

原文地址:http://www.cnblogs.com/IFLabs/p/4252321.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!